What Is Intricate Bowel Care?
Complex digestive tract care incorporates procedures and strategies for people that experience considerable obstacles in handling their bowel movements. This could include:
Constipation Management: Techniques to reduce constipation making use of nutritional changes or medications. Enema Administration: Giving injections safely when prescribed. Suppository Insertion: Educating on the correct techniques for suppository use. Monitoring Symptoms: Keeping an eye on any type of modifications or problems that arise. Why Is It Important?
Effective bowel care is crucial not simply for physical health and wellness but additionally for mental wellness. People with handicaps often face additional obstacles to preserving their bowel health, which can lead to difficulties such as:
Pain and discomfort Increased threat of infections Social seclusion because of embarrassment
By understanding these complexities, impairment employees can considerably enhance their clients' high quality of life.

Techniques in Taking care of Facility Digestive Tract Needs 1. Dietary Interventions
Diet plays an important function in maintaining healthy and balanced bowel function.
High-Fiber Diets
Encouraging fiber-rich foods can assist stop bowel irregularity:
|Food Type|Instances|| ------------------|-------------------------------|| Fruits|Apples, pears|| Vegetables|Broccoli, carrots|| Whole Grains|Oats, wild rice|
2. Hydration Strategies
Adequate fluid intake sustains digestion and can prevent constipation.
Recommended Daily Intake
Aim for a minimum of 8 glasses (64 ounces) daily unless or else encouraged by a clinical professional.
3. Physical Activity Recommendations
Physical task advertises consistency in defecation, making it essential for clients who are able to take part in exercise safely.
